or ya use the print screen button, (right about the insert key on most keyboards)
anyways get IrfanView, www.irfanview.com and here is the workflow i use for printscreens
- IN WINGS
_get view you want
_hit the print screen button
-IN IRFAN VIEW
_hit ctrl+v to paste the screen capture into IF
_(you will want to crop the image) select portion of the screeny you wish to show (just drag selection) hit ctrl+y to crop
_(you might also want to resize) hit ctrl+r to open the resize window (set any settings you want, i usually go for a 50 percent resize… but thats usually because im at 1600x1200 ressolution :))
_hit the “s” key to save as
_enter a name for the image + select image type to save to, i usually do .jpg at 70% to 80% compress
_hit ok
and there you have it. really though this is what it looks like without my explaining each step
